Your impact
At Jacobs, we’re not just building structures, we’re helping our clients innovate and grow by designing, engineering, and executing the construction of their state-of-the-art facilities that are changing our world.
We’re looking for an experienced and collaborative Construction Superintendent - Mechanical/Piping in Guaynabo, PR who thrives when people are in sync and construction projects are running like they should. You’ll take the lead on daily scheduling and planning activities at the project site, and ensure the right materials, equipment and people are there to get the job done. Most importantly, you’ll take action to ensure the safety, health and well-being of your team and our planet. As a passionate leader, you’ll leverage your people management skills to help your team members discover what drives them, nurturing their purpose and guiding them forward. Your role keeps our company connected and we’ll support you with what you need to be successful.
Bring your curiosity, passion for innovation, and talent for multi-tasking in a fast-paced environment. We’ll help you grow, pursue and fulfill what inspires you – so we can make big impacts on the world, together.
Here's what you'll need
- Associate or bachelor’s degree in engineering, construction management or other; or equivalent years of experience in lieu of degree
- At least 4\+ years of construction site experience preferred
- Experience with hygienic and non-hygienic piping preferred
- Experience leading contractors and Superintendents for current scope, engineering information, and document drawings/specifications for construction execution.
- Working knowledge of pre-design and pre-construction, building systems/components and technology, contract management, project delivery methods, team building and client relationship building required.
- Ability to review and assist with Mechanical, Equipment \& Piping (M/E/P) scopes of work from the initial Bid Phase
- Experience with managing project or scope package budgets
- Experience with the management of a project schedule.
Ideally, you’ll also have:
- Pharma experience
- Collaborating in planning, design, construction and commissioning
- Excellent communications skill
- Proficient in use of software as Power Point, Excel, Word, 3D Model, and Bluebeam
- Facilitate and coordinate walkdowns and meetings and/or reviews with owner and designers
- Attend constructability reviews
- Lead client and construction meetings.
- Coordinate construction activities on the site
- Safety leader (JHA’s revision / daily signed off permits)
- Quality in construction
- Participate on Turn over process including TOP’s, punch list and walkdowns with contractors and owners.
- OSHA 30

Our health and welfare benefits are designed to invest in you and in the things you care about. Your health. Your well-being. Your security. Your future. Eligible employees and their dependents may elect medical, dental, vision, and basic life insurance. Employees are able to enroll in our company’s 401(k) plan, and, if eligible, a deferred compensation plan and Executive Deferral Plan. Employees will also receive 17 days of vacation per year, seven paid holidays, and caregiver leave. Hired applicants will be able to purchase company stock and have the opportunity to receive a performance discretionary bonus.
The base salary range for this position is $78,200\.00 to $120,000\.00\.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training.
